From b33e97e259d6f5c7358643a720d5e5c0974f3e66 Mon Sep 17 00:00:00 2001 From: Lars Wendler Date: Fri, 6 Aug 2010 23:15:05 +0000 Subject: Version bump. Removed old. Package-Manager: portage-2.2_rc67/cvs/Linux x86_64 --- app-emulation/virtualbox-modules/ChangeLog | 8 ++- app-emulation/virtualbox-modules/Manifest | 6 +- .../virtualbox-modules-3.2.4.ebuild | 72 ---------------------- .../virtualbox-modules-3.2.8.ebuild | 72 ++++++++++++++++++++++ 4 files changed, 82 insertions(+), 76 deletions(-) delete mode 100644 app-emulation/virtualbox-modules/virtualbox-modules-3.2.4.ebuild create mode 100644 app-emulation/virtualbox-modules/virtualbox-modules-3.2.8.ebuild diff --git a/app-emulation/virtualbox-modules/ChangeLog b/app-emulation/virtualbox-modules/ChangeLog index cbb53d1f7bae..9b4f07eb2e69 100644 --- a/app-emulation/virtualbox-modules/ChangeLog +++ b/app-emulation/virtualbox-modules/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for app-emulation/virtualbox-modules #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-emulation/virtualbox-modules/ChangeLog,v 1.68 2010/08/01 12:26:33 polynomial-c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-emulation/virtualbox-modules/ChangeLog,v 1.69 2010/08/06 23:15:05 polynomial-c Exp $ + +*virtualbox-modules-3.2.8 (06 Aug 2010) + + 06 Aug 2010; Lars Wendler + -virtualbox-modules-3.2.4.ebuild, +virtualbox-modules-3.2.8.ebuild: + Version bump. Removed old. 01 Aug 2010; Lars Wendler virtualbox-modules-3.1.8.ebuild, virtualbox-modules-3.2.4.ebuild, diff --git a/app-emulation/virtualbox-modules/Manifest b/app-emulation/virtualbox-modules/Manifest index 6bdd7c3aa004..851a26579209 100644 --- a/app-emulation/virtualbox-modules/Manifest +++ b/app-emulation/virtualbox-modules/Manifest @@ -1,8 +1,8 @@ DIST vbox-kernel-module-src-3.1.8.tar.bz2 690589 RMD160 5d8187d2652ad5f2985413308a967e4ef77e9841 SHA1 aefdd73c81151801091ff3ca274005abb8663e81 SHA256 3bcf21168fbb6e1333c512073fcf7cab41efa9bb01ba50a14ecebd615b63becc -DIST vbox-kernel-module-src-3.2.4.tar.bz2 767416 RMD160 da1e10a667f9d2b9c88b8e190d3b3d8c128aa58a SHA1 47ad2158745ef04c68cc90cc4da4a96fdf68d9a9 SHA256 68ce8c08f61397e86d6768cce1bc3d5255f6351fa89e012d2df690170fabcca4 DIST vbox-kernel-module-src-3.2.6.tar.bz2 768409 RMD160 8b9606dbfee5730c9dc0be4a5503ec059f44fd61 SHA1 95f566b59a87b7d97d5e48cbba5a9b78aba2e50f SHA256 18831b9c656b5f47c1ba44d3dd10b734b5c24f02b93e11c5673cb84d91afcd99 +DIST vbox-kernel-module-src-3.2.8.tar.bz2 769271 RMD160 9b6cb40920fa69525da8100921a5e8e6aadb4bf2 SHA1 2266c7362b1b7f83b615fd96d2a1c3cad906d236 SHA256 4e2fca5c67305f4a5cc9ca001e981af09fbcfc6cb347d10a95f2bc7f576af302 EBUILD virtualbox-modules-3.1.8.ebuild 2110 RMD160 bf6100f709b79b56f95ca0256017f3a0c31696fb SHA1 efc2bf484ed30ab305ff497de39a916eaa5191cb SHA256 4ea1e74d091a2ff78fc7f8b0591790389a9ac90cacad2f969d2a783b418a5611 -EBUILD virtualbox-modules-3.2.4.ebuild 2112 RMD160 2ce7501262cb1661a1cf3a235dfe904fe671007e SHA1 3c9eed8cecf3bd780e9ad4ba68b6ad118851b97f SHA256 dfe1e0702da347763dda4237fd03f1c41112b4053fc1fd4f5bf0f820748a2040 EBUILD virtualbox-modules-3.2.6.ebuild 2112 RMD160 f196d10ef384bfc03a46fff91f2041027e152bb6 SHA1 ec01638ecc764d8376f9c33346c9135fea8d466d SHA256 870ec5d72bbb914f37bc6d1b26ad68737496087c884a018e5639965605d872a3 -MISC ChangeLog 12222 RMD160 93af69c1c925ce0878ae5e5dca94a6fd97baf4c3 SHA1 c3b9fd2744cb1b499a6dabe6c357969e22f78729 SHA256 db4e1ba92ad848ae89e199d265e71b93e29c122ee3e1babf3aafca734cd8bd16 +EBUILD virtualbox-modules-3.2.8.ebuild 2112 RMD160 e7c38070339d5a9d827dd429f7d6287d63d3e48a SHA1 f2334e9826fa8b38a9223a761bd39ec46f7f4587 SHA256 2f746a7228216bed9461bc9d7d7bd30fbb83d3891a66d0b846cbd2bfd932067f +MISC ChangeLog 12417 RMD160 4e289ccc0b680a926f5aacf06ba79a294eef15a2 SHA1 5bd4f8c9558904e1aa6565a9fd52ac3b5dcf4d36 SHA256 85f17845d978285ed671d40d7e8f3bd6861445abcf7bcc2996441abb9d879bea MISC metadata.xml 457 RMD160 12d3d923e95f66b27bd9456b76319b9a6d8ae815 SHA1 54139c285252e9229298cf32d0716062cde5f0de SHA256 1fbd88d74325c1c6c63512eb9b7185797d6b9992b8c4f809d51897252729eccf diff --git a/app-emulation/virtualbox-modules/virtualbox-modules-3.2.4.ebuild b/app-emulation/virtualbox-modules/virtualbox-modules-3.2.4.ebuild deleted file mode 100644 index 7096b0b10320..000000000000 --- a/app-emulation/virtualbox-modules/virtualbox-modules-3.2.4.ebuild +++ /dev/null @@ -1,72 +0,0 @@ -# Copyright 1999-2010 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-emulation/virtualbox-modules/virtualbox-modules-3.2.4.ebuild,v 1.2 2010/08/01 12:26:33 polynomial-c Exp $ - -# XXX: the tarball here is just the kernel modules split out of the binary -# package that comes from virtualbox-bin - -EAPI=2 - -inherit eutils linux-mod - -MY_P=vbox-kernel-module-src-${PV} -DESCRIPTION="Kernel Modules for Virtualbox" -HOMEPAGE="http://www.virtualbox.org/" -SRC_URI="http://dev.gentoo.org/~polynomial-c/virtualbox/${MY_P}.tar.bz2"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="~amd64 ~x86" -IUSE="" - -RDEPEND="!=app-emulation/virtualbox-ose-9999" - -S=${WORKDIR} - -BUILD_TARGETS="all" -BUILD_TARGET_ARCH="${ARCH}" -MODULE_NAMES="vboxdrv(misc:${S}) vboxnetflt(misc:${S}) vboxnetadp(misc:${S})" - -pkg_setup() { - linux-mod_pkg_setup - BUILD_PARAMS="KERN_DIR=${KV_DIR} KERNOUT=${KV_OUT_DIR}" - enewgroup vboxusers -} - -src_prepare() { - if kernel_is -ge 2 6 33 ; then - # evil patch for new kernels - header moved - grep -lR linux/autoconf.h * | xargs sed -i -e 's:::' - fi -} - -src_install() { - linux-mod_src_install - - # udev rule for vboxdrv - dodir /etc/udev/rules.d - echo '#SUBSYSTEM=="usb_device", GROUP="vboxusers", MODE="0644"' \ - > "${D}/etc/udev/rules.d/10-virtualbox.rules" - echo '#SUBSYSTEM=="usb", ENV{DEVTYPE}=="usb_device", GROUP="vboxusers", MODE="0644"' \ - >> "${D}/etc/udev/rules.d/10-virtualbox.rules" -} - -pkg_postinst() { - linux-mod_pkg_postinst - elog "Starting with the 3.x release new kernel modules were added," - elog "be sure to load all the needed modules." - elog "" - elog "Please add \"vboxdrv\", \"vboxnetflt\" and \"vboxnetadp\" to:" - if has_version sys-apps/openrc; then - elog "/etc/conf.d/modules" - else - elog "/etc/modules.autoload.d/kernel-${KV_MAJOR}.${KV_MINOR}" - fi - elog "" - elog "If you are experiencing problems on your guests" - elog "with USB support and app-emulation/virtualbox-bin," - elog "uncomment the udev rules placed in:" - elog "" - elog "/etc/udev/rules.d/10-virtualbox.rules" - elog "" -} diff --git a/app-emulation/virtualbox-modules/virtualbox-modules-3.2.8.ebuild b/app-emulation/virtualbox-modules/virtualbox-modules-3.2.8.ebuild new file mode 100644 index 000000000000..4aa47c4eb89f --- /dev/null +++ b/app-emulation/virtualbox-modules/virtualbox-modules-3.2.8.ebuild @@ -0,0 +1,72 @@ +# Copyright 1999-2010 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/app-emulation/virtualbox-modules/virtualbox-modules-3.2.8.ebuild,v 1.1 2010/08/06 23:15:05 polynomial-c Exp $ + +# XXX: the tarball here is just the kernel modules split out of the binary +# package that comes from virtualbox-bin + +EAPI=2 + +inherit eutils linux-mod + +MY_P=vbox-kernel-module-src-${PV} +DESCRIPTION="Kernel Modules for Virtualbox" +HOMEPAGE="http://www.virtualbox.org/" +SRC_URI="http://dev.gentoo.org/~polynomial-c/virtualbox/${MY_P}.tar.bz2"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="" + +RDEPEND="!=app-emulation/virtualbox-ose-9999" + +S=${WORKDIR} + +BUILD_TARGETS="all" +BUILD_TARGET_ARCH="${ARCH}" +MODULE_NAMES="vboxdrv(misc:${S}) vboxnetflt(misc:${S}) vboxnetadp(misc:${S})" + +pkg_setup() { + linux-mod_pkg_setup + BUILD_PARAMS="KERN_DIR=${KV_DIR} KERNOUT=${KV_OUT_DIR}" + enewgroup vboxusers +} + +src_prepare() { + if kernel_is -ge 2 6 33 ; then + # evil patch for new kernels - header moved + grep -lR linux/autoconf.h * | xargs sed -i -e 's:::' + fi +} + +src_install() { + linux-mod_src_install + + # udev rule for vboxdrv + dodir /etc/udev/rules.d + echo '#SUBSYSTEM=="usb_device", GROUP="vboxusers", MODE="0644"' \ + > "${D}/etc/udev/rules.d/10-virtualbox.rules" + echo '#SUBSYSTEM=="usb", ENV{DEVTYPE}=="usb_device", GROUP="vboxusers", MODE="0644"' \ + >> "${D}/etc/udev/rules.d/10-virtualbox.rules" +} + +pkg_postinst() { + linux-mod_pkg_postinst + elog "Starting with the 3.x release new kernel modules were added," + elog "be sure to load all the needed modules." + elog "" + elog "Please add \"vboxdrv\", \"vboxnetflt\" and \"vboxnetadp\" to:" + if has_version sys-apps/openrc; then + elog "/etc/conf.d/modules" + else + elog "/etc/modules.autoload.d/kernel-${KV_MAJOR}.${KV_MINOR}" + fi + elog "" + elog "If you are experiencing problems on your guests" + elog "with USB support and app-emulation/virtualbox-bin," + elog "uncomment the udev rules placed in:" + elog "" + elog "/etc/udev/rules.d/10-virtualbox.rules" + elog "" +} -- cgit v1.2.3-65-gdbad